Luang Prabang International Airport (Lao: ສະຫນາມບິນສາກົນຫຼວງພະບາງ), (IATA: LPQ, ICAO: VLLB) is one of the three international airports in Laos. The airport is located about 4 kilometres (2.5 mi) from the centre of Luang Prabang. The second busiest airport in the country, it is a regional hub for international flights to Bangkok, Chiang Mai in Thailand and Siem Reap in Cambodia as well as domestically to Vientiane. The airport underwent significant expansion work in 2012–13, when it was upgraded and expanded, and the runway enlarged.
